Overview: Founded in 2010 by Vijay Shekhar Sharma, Paytm started as a mobile recharge platform and has evolved into a comprehensive financial ecosystem. It offers services including digital payments, financial services, e-commerce, and ticketing.

Key Features:

  • Digital wallet and UPI payments
  • Paytm Bank with savings accounts and debit cards
  • Mutual funds and insurance products
  • E-commerce and bill payments

Impact: Paytm has revolutionized digital payments in India, making cashless transactions a mainstream phenomenon and boosting financial inclusion across the country.

Overview: Launched in 2015 by Sameer Nigam, Rahul Chari, and Burzin Engineer, PhonePe is a leading digital payments platform in India. It offers UPI-based payments, mobile recharges, utility bill payments, and financial services.

Key Features:

  • UPI payments and money transfers
  • Mobile recharges and bill payments
  • Mutual funds and insurance products
  • PhonePe Switch for seamless integration with third-party apps

Impact: PhonePe has made digital transactions quick and easy, promoting the adoption of UPI and transforming the way Indians manage their finances.

Overview: Founded in 2014 by Harshil Mathur and Shashank Kumar, Razorpay is a full-stack financial solutions company. It provides payment gateway services, business banking, and lending solutions.

Key Features:

  • Payment gateway supporting multiple payment modes
  • RazorpayX for business banking and payroll management
  • Razorpay Capital for quick business loans
  • Razorpay Thirdwatch for fraud prevention

Impact: Razorpay has streamlined online payments for businesses, enabling seamless transactions and providing essential financial tools to manage operations efficiently.

Overview: PolicyBazaar, founded in 2008 by Yashish Dahiya, Alok Bansal, and Avaneesh Nirjar, is an insurance aggregator platform. It helps users compare and purchase insurance policies online.

Key Features:

  • Comparison of life, health, motor, and travel insurance policies
  • In-depth information and reviews of insurance products
  • Online policy purchase and renewal
  • Claim assistance and customer support

Impact: PolicyBazaar has democratized access to insurance by providing transparency and empowering users to make informed decisions about their insurance needs.

Overview: Founded in 2018 by Kunal Shah, Cred is a platform that rewards users for paying their credit card bills on time. It offers exclusive rewards and financial insights.

Key Features:

  • Rewards and cashback for timely credit card bill payments
  • Credit score monitoring and analysis
  • CRED Stash for low-interest personal loans
  • Access to premium brands and exclusive offers

Impact: Cred has incentivized responsible credit behavior and provided users with valuable financial insights, promoting better financial management.

Overview: Groww, established in 2016 by Lalit Keshre, Harsh Jain, Neeraj Singh, and Ishan Bansal, is an investment platform that allows users to invest in mutual funds, stocks, and other financial products.

Key Features:

  • Direct mutual fund investments with no commission
  • Stock trading and investment
  • Digital gold and fixed deposits
  • User-friendly app with educational resources

Impact: Groww has simplified investing for millennials and new investors, making wealth management accessible and straightforward.

Overview: Zerodha, founded in 2010 by Nithin Kamath and Nikhil Kamath, is a discount brokerage firm that has transformed the brokerage industry with its low-cost trading services.

Key Features:

  • Low brokerage fees for trading in stocks, commodities, and derivatives
  • Kite trading platform with advanced charting tools
  • Coin for direct mutual fund investments
  • Varsity for educational content on trading and investments

Impact: Zerodha has democratized stock trading in India, offering affordable and user-friendly trading solutions to retail investors.

Overview: Lendingkart, founded in 2014 by Harshvardhan Lunia and Mukul Sachan, is a fintech company that provides working capital loans to small and medium enterprises (SMEs).

Key Features:

  • Collateral-free business loans
  • Quick approval and disbursal process
  • Data-driven credit scoring model
  • Flexible repayment terms

Impact: Lendingkart has supported the growth of SMEs by providing easy access to working capital, helping businesses expand and manage their operations more effectively.

Q: How does PolicyBazaar make money?
A: PolicyBazaar earns revenue through commissions paid by insurance companies for policies sold through its platform.

Q: Can I renew my insurance policies through PolicyBazaar?
A: Yes, PolicyBazaar allows users to compare and renew their insurance policies online.

Q: Is PolicyBazaar affiliated with any insurance company?
A: PolicyBazaar is an independent insurance aggregator and is not affiliated with any specific insurance company.

Q: What are the brokerage charges for trading with Zerodha?
A: Zerodha offers competitive brokerage rates, including zero brokerage for equity delivery trades. Other trades incur flat fees or a percentage of the trade value.

Q: Can I invest in mutual funds through Zerodha?
A: Yes, Zerodha offers a platform called Coin for investing in direct mutual funds with no commission fees.

Q: How can I open an account with Zerodha?
A: You can open an account with Zerodha online by filling out the account opening form and completing the KYC process.
